His CD opens with “Thirst for Life,” which has Greek flairs to it, and it is followed by the lilting “Rapture,” which features ethereal vocals. “Drive” is more laid-back, while the uplifting “What You Get” feels like a true musical adventure. His single “Desert Soul” has been praised by Digital Journal for being “mesmerizing,” and rightfully so. “1001” has a stunning beat to it and “The Keeper” has an easy-listening vibe to it.
One of the album’s prime cuts includes “Whispers in the Dark,” while “Seeing You Around” is a soothing vocal performance. “Orchid” is more empowering and “A Little Too Late” features hypnotic humming, as it were sung by a musical siren. “Dance for Me” has a sultry, Latin vibe and “Retreat to Dream” is more upbeat.
The piano-driven “Test of Time” is angelic, and it closes with the ballad “Can’t Wait” and “I’m So.”

The Verdict
Overall, Yanni’s latest studio effort is solid from start to finish. It may be different than his previous musical work, but it still garners 4 out of 5 stars.
